At SES Space & Defense, we are a trusted partner ensuring mission success for customers operating in the most demanding environments. As part of SES S.A., a global leader in satellite-enabled connectivity, we deliver multi-orbit, end-to-end satellite and technology solutions that provide secure, reliable, and high-bandwidth communications across the globe.
Our differentiated multi-orbit architecture combines GEO and MEO satellite systems with integrated terrestrial and network infrastructure to deliver resilient, low-latency, high-throughput connectivity at a global scale. With more than 120 satellites covering nearly the entire world, a global ground network, and thousands of deployed terminals supporting over 5,000 government missions annually, SES Space and Defense is a trusted partner to the U.S. Federal Government and national security community, allied governments, NATO, and agencies including NASA for mission‑critical communications.

What You’ll Do:In this role, you’ll lead the execution of complex, cross‑functional programs across SES Space & Defense, ensuring major initiatives are delivered on time, within budget, and aligned to customer and business objectives. You’ll oversee a team of program and project managers while driving consistent program execution, financial discipline, executive‑level reporting, and continuous improvement across the PMO. This role sits at the center of program delivery, connecting customers, engineering, operations, finance, contracts, supply chain, subcontractors, and senior leadership to ensure high‑value programs move from planning through execution, launch, deployment, and operational transition.
- Provide strategic and operational leadership for complex programs from initial design through launch, deployment, and operational transition.
- Own program performance across scope, schedule, cost, risk, quality, technical execution, and customer commitments.
- Lead development and management of key program baselines, including Work Breakdown Structures, Integrated Master Schedules, program plans, and delivery milestones.
- Manage program financial performance, including budgets, forecasts, EAC/ETC, revenue recognition, cash flow, margin performance, and recovery planning.
- Serve as a primary customer and stakeholder interface, leading formal reviews, managing expectations, negotiating changes, and communicating program risks and progress.
- Lead integrated program teams across engineering, systems engineering, operations, supply chain, contracts, finance, product development, and other cross‑functional groups.
- Manage major subcontractors, vendors, and partners, including SOW definition, milestone tracking, performance oversight, contractual compliance, and risk mitigation.
- Establish and maintain disciplined risk, issue, opportunity, configuration control, and change management processes to protect program baseline integrity.
- Ensure compliance with contractual requirements, government regulations, export controls, quality standards, CDRLs, data packages, and program documentation.
- Mentor program managers and project leads while improving PMO tools, templates, processes, best practices, and lessons‑learned discipline.
